За последние 24 часа нас посетили 22816 программистов и 1261 робот. Сейчас ищут 752 программиста ...

get_defined_vars ( ) непонятный порядок переменных

Тема в разделе "PHP для новичков", создана пользователем Александр101, 20 апр 2021.

  1. Александр101

    Александр101 Новичок

    С нами с:
    20 апр 2021
    Сообщения:
    29
    Симпатии:
    0
    Приветствую.
    Функция get_defined_vars ( ), на той странице, на которой установлена, возвращает массив переменных в порядке их объявления. Что и ожидал.

    Часть массива переменных приходит с другой, подключённой, страницы, И вот эта часть имеет перепутанный порядок, не тот в котором переменные объявлялись на той странице. Это нормально?
     
  2. mkramer

    mkramer Суперстар
    Команда форума Модератор

    С нами с:
    20 июн 2012
    Сообщения:
    8.555
    Симпатии:
    1.754
    Вполне. А какая разница? А вообще, основную логику программы я бы на этой функции не строил. Это скорее для целей отладки введено в язык.
     
    don.bidon нравится это.
  3. Александр101

    Александр101 Новичок

    С нами с:
    20 апр 2021
    Сообщения:
    29
    Симпатии:
    0
    Благодарю. Я так и подумал. Рассматривал подходы к решению новой задачи и решил уточнить глюк это или нормально. Вернусь к традиционному формированию массивов.